Address

14AH7EfuMEEPc6JY2PyyJqAkMjYQyT4zUF
Confirmed tx count
314
Confirmed received
160 outputs (0.54161401 BTC)
Confirmed spent
160 outputs (0.54161401 BTC)
Confirmed unspent
No outputs

25 of 314 Transactions